### ThumbForge Image Cache

Quick heads up for new folks: ThumbForge's in-memory cache had a leak where evicted bitmaps kept a handle to the decode pool, so memory climbed until the worker got OOM-killed. Fixed in 2.9, but you'll still see it on older nodes. To pull heap snapshots from a suspect node, hit the diagnostics endpoint, which authenticates with the key below.

gateway credential: kto23_LX9A4ys6i4nzHtpOLNLodKK

Hi Devran,

Handover for the telemetry compression work on Fluxline. The zstd rollout is at 40%; payload sizes are down ~60% with no decode errors. Our new contractor will pick up the dashboard work Monday — walk them through the sampling config first. For any questions during onboarding, they can write to this address.

escalation mailbox, bafog-fafog: ulador@paliqlabs.internal

# Break-Glass: Catalog Cache Invalidation

Scope: the Pinrow product catalog at Veldstone Retail. If stale prices persist after a purge and the Hollowmere invalidation queue is wedged, use break-glass to flush the edge tier directly. Contractors: get verbal sign-off from the catalog lead first. Steps: open the Hollowmere admin shell, select emergency-flush, confirm the tenant, and run it once — repeated flushes thrash the origin. Access is logged and expires after 20 minutes. Unseal the admin shell with the passphrase below.

recovery phrase for kahop-tajog: istix-casvan

Leadership Review Briefing — Project Tidewater

Target: Morvale Logistics, a regional carrier with strong cold-chain capacity. Valuation range agreed internally; diligence underway. Fit: closes our coverage gap in the Arden corridor. Risks: fleet age, union negotiations. Decision point at next leadership review. Do not discuss outside this group. The strategic rationale is summarized below.

confidential, kagep-kahof: Druokax Systems plans to lower the Ulaath list price by 53 percent in March.